Summary
As the SR Firmware Engineer, you will be working on sophisticated, industrial, real time operating systems involving real time data acquisition and post processing of data for analysis and reports. This team of engineers develops innovative monitoring systems used for transformer monitoring at electrical sub stations.

Required Skills and Experience
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field.
Minimum of 5 years of hands-on experience in embedded systems design, development, testing, and debugging.
Strong experience with microcontroller and microprocessor-based systems.
Expertise in Embedded C/C++ development within real-time, multi-threaded environments.
Proficiency in programming peripheral interfaces like UART, I2C, SPI, etc.
Proven experience in developing, debugging, and testing industrial protocols such as Modbus, DNP3, IEC60870, IEC61850, along with expertise in Ethernet systems, protocol analyzers, and SCADA practices.
Extensive experience with embedded Linux and Windows environments, including real-time data acquisition and scheduling applications.
Knowledge of unit testing frameworks for Linux.
Experience with device driver programming.
Preferred Skills
Experience in developing products for the power utility industry.
Familiarity with AI technologies in firmware development.
Understanding of cybersecurity implementation principles.
Experience with FPGA programming and development.
Proficiency in additional programming languages such as C#, PHP, JS, and scripting languages like Python.
Familiarity with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) practices.
Experience with JIRA and Confluence.
Familiarity with Agile methodologies.
